Exploring the Applications and Benefits of Copilot Mode in Access Control and Identity Management

In the modern enterprise, effective access control and identity management are critical for maintaining security and compliance. The integration of Copilot mode, utilizing GenAI, LLM, and chatbot technologies, significantly enhances these processes. This article delves into the specific use cases where Copilot mode assists in access approvals, internal control processes, and user identity and access management, demonstrating its impact on improving efficiency and quality.

Applications of Copilot Mode in Access Control and Identity Management

  1. Compliance Training Reminders

    • GenAI-driven Copilot sends notifications to employees about upcoming compliance training sessions, including date, time, and location, along with relevant resource links to help them prepare adequately.
  2. Multi-Factor Authentication Requests

    • Copilot prompts employees to complete multi-factor authentication when accessing sensitive systems or applications, helping to prevent unauthorized access and enhance security.
  3. Security Incident Alerts

    • In the event of a security incident such as a data breach or phishing attempt, Copilot sends notifications to employees, guiding them on how to protect themselves and report any suspicious activity.
  4. Querying User Access Permissions

    • Copilot enables employees to search and view specific user access permissions for various systems and applications, facilitating better oversight and management of access rights.
  5. Checking Password Expiry

    • Copilot allows employees to quickly check the expiry dates of their passwords, ensuring compliance with the latest security protocols and preventing potential access issues.
  6. Viewing Access Requests

    • Copilot provides employees with a convenient way to view the status of access requests across different systems and applications, keeping them informed of their progress.
  7. Resetting Passwords

    • Copilot guides employees through the process of resetting their passwords, minimizing the need for IT support and ensuring secure access to company systems.
  8. Requesting Access

    • Copilot assists employees in requesting access to specific applications or systems, ensuring proper authorization and reducing security risks.
  9. Updating Personal Information

    • Copilot guides employees in updating their personal information, ensuring their accounts are current and they receive relevant communications.
